Analysis on Operation and Management Problems of Micro Enterprises under Online-Offline Integration Mode
Huang Guoshui
Hainan Vocational University of Science and Technology
Abstract:
Driven by the booming digital economy and omnichannel commercial transformation, online-offline integration has become a vital strategy for micro enterprises to expand markets and enhance customer loyalty. Unlike large and medium-sized enterprises with sound organizational systems and sufficient digital resources, micro enterprises face prominent operational and managerial bottlenecks due to their small scale, capital shortages, and limited digital capabilities during dual-channel transformation. This paper explores four core operational problems of micro enterprises in channel collaboration, inventory governance, digital operation, and talent management, and analyzes their underlying causes. Corresponding targeted strategies are proposed to promote channel integration, refined inventory management, digital upgrading, and talent development. The findings provide practical references for micro enterprises to achieve steady digital transformation, cut operating costs, improve operational efficiency, and support sustainable development.
Key Words:
micro enterprises; online-offline integration; omnichannel operation
